Boyertown, Pennsylvania AA Meetings

Are you looking for AA meetings in Boyertown? Boyertown is a borough in berks County, Pennsylvania. Boyertown is mildly populated and has its fair share of residents dealing with alcohol use disorder. AUD is a destructive pattern that includes excessive consumption of alcohol even in inappropriate locations and activities such as driving or swimming, being unable to stop drinking even when the consequences dire, being occupied with drinking or alcohol use and neglecting important obligations at work, school or home. Most individuals dealing with alcohol use disorder have a hard time quitting mainly because they don’t consider it a problem and don’t seek help for it. This happens because drinking is accepted among the society especially in the United States and many don’t consider it the dangerous addictive drug that it is. Alcohol use disorder, in addition to its addictive nature, can have a major influence over a life. Alcoholics make it a priority risking the relationships with the people around them causing personal problems. Alcoholics Anonymous Pennsylvania recognizes the difficulty of quitting alcohol on your own and the effect of alcohol abuse. They also understand the need for support while going through this process since every member are going through similar struggles.
